What Is the Bevel Angle (Lens Edge)?

The bevel angle is the sloped edge of an eyeglass lens that allows it to fit securely into the groove of the frame. This angled cut keeps the lens stable and properly aligned within the eyewire. The shape and depth of the bevel can differ based on the frame type, such as full-rim, semi-rimless, or rimless designs. A well-shaped bevel supports both the durability and comfort of the finished eyewear.

What Is the Purpose of the Bevel Angle?

The bevel angle helps the lens stay firmly in place and prevents it from slipping or breaking. It also spreads pressure evenly across the lens edge, which reduces the chance of cracks. A well-fitted bevel gives the eyewear a smooth appearance and helps maintain clear, balanced vision.

How Is the Bevel Angle Determined?

The bevel angle depends on lens thickness, curvature, and the type of frame used. Thicker lenses or wraparound designs may need a deeper or wider bevel to achieve a proper fit. Opticians use precision edging machines to shape the bevel so it matches the frame's groove, helping the lens sit evenly and securely.

What Are the Types of Bevels Used in Eyewear?

Common bevel styles include:

  • Standard Bevel: Used for most plastic and metal frames, with a centered edge for balanced placement.
  • Front Bevel: Positioned closer to the front surface of the lens, often used in wraparound or curved frames.
  • Rear Bevel: Placed toward the back of the lens, suitable for special frame designs or cosmetic needs.
  • Flat Edge: Found in rimless or semi-rimless frames where lenses are held by screws or nylon cords.

How Is the Bevel Angle Measured or Adjusted?

Opticians measure and shape the bevel using automated edging tools or manual techniques. The angle is adjusted to fit the specific frame groove and lens curvature. Before final assembly, the lens is checked to confirm that it sits flush and secure within the frame.

When to Have Your Frames Checked

If your lenses feel loose or sit unevenly in the frame, the bevel angle may need adjustment. This angle affects how securely a lens fits in the groove. An optician can inspect and correct the alignment. Secure fit reduces the chance of lens movement or damage. Routine checks help maintain long-lasting frames.

Frequently Asked Questions

What is the bevel angle on a lens edge?

The bevel angle is the slanted cut around the lens edge that helps the lens lock into the frame groove. It affects how securely the lens sits and how the front and back surfaces align with the frame. Different frames and lens thicknesses call for different bevel placement. A proper bevel reduces the chance of the lens popping out or sitting unevenly.

Why does bevel placement vary?

Thicker lenses can need bevel shifts so the lens sits better cosmetically and physically in the frame. Curved or wrap frames may need a bevel closer to the front to match the frame groove path. Some designs use a flatter edge for rimless or semi-rimless mounting. The goal is stable seating without excess pressure that can crack the lens.

Can a bad bevel cause comfort or fit issues?

Yes, a poor bevel can make a lens feel loose, sit tilted, or create pressure points in the frame. It can also affect how the frame sits on the face if one lens is not seated evenly. Some people notice visual issues when optical alignment shifts due to uneven seating. An optician can re-edge the lens when the bevel is the problem.

When should someone get the bevel checked?

If a lens keeps popping out, rattles, or looks misaligned, the bevel and groove match should be inspected. Fit checks are also helpful after a frame impact or bend. Routine maintenance can catch loose seating before it becomes a break or scratch issue. Bringing the glasses to an optical shop is usually the fastest fix.
